Retake - Making the World's First Haida-Language Feature Film
“"If we lose the language, we will no longer be Haida – Haida is the only thing that distinguishes us from other people." - Delores Churchill”
Retake follows the journey of co-directors Gwaai Edenshaw (Haida) and Helen Haig-Brown (Tsilhqot'in) as they work to produce The Edge of the Knife, a feature-length film told entirely in the critically-endangered Haida language. The film tells the story of a traditional Haida legend, showcasing the Haida culture in many ways that have never been seen by a broad audience.
